Speakers

Agnès Boudot

Senior Vice President for HPC, AI and Quantum, Atos

Agnès Boudot is the Senior Vice President for HPC, AI and Quantum Business Line within Big Data & Security Division at Atos since January 2017. She oversees the HPC and Quantum business for Atos group, she owns the portfolio definition and manages the HPC & Quantum sales and support Operations worldwide. Before taking this position, Agnès led the HPC Sales for France, working on developing the HPC business on major accounts such as CEA, GENCI, Météo France,… Before joining Bull (now part of the Atos Group) in 2010, Agnès worked for Cray and SGI (now part of HPE) for 20 years and grew her experience in HPC in different Technical and Sales support positions, from Software System engineer to Presales Manager for Europe. Agnès started her career at CEA as a System Software specialist in 1990.

In parallel to her current HPC, AI and Quantum leadership role, Agnes Boudot is also CTO for the Public Sector & Defense Industry since February 2020

Cédric Bourrasset

HPC-AI Sales Operations Lead in the Atos HPC, AI & Quantum division, Atos

After receiving a Ph.D. in Electronics and computer vision in 2016 from the Blaise Pascal University in France defending the dataflow model of computation for FPGA High Level Synthesis problematic in embedded machine learning application, Cédric Bourrasset is now HPC-AI Sales Operations Lead in the Atos HPC, AI & Quantum division, in charge of the Atos Codex AI Suite software solution.

Steve Hebert

VP and Global Head of Cloud HPC for Atos-Nimbix

Steve Hebert started in technical sales in semiconductors with Texas Instruments after earning his degree in Electrical Engineering from Santa Clara University. Today, he is a technology industry veteran of over 25 years with a strong track record of operational execution and sales growth at both startup and large companies. In 2010, Steve founded cloud supercomputing company, Nimbix, Inc. in Dallas which was acquired in July of 2021 by leading global technology firm, Atos SE based in Paris. Steve now serves as VP and Global Head of Cloud HPC for Atos-Nimbix.

Jean-Pierre Panziera

Chief Technology Director for Extreme Computing, Atos

Jean-Pierre Panziera is the Chief Technology Director for Extreme Computing at Atos. He is also the Chairman of the ETP4HPC association and of the EuroHPC Research and Innovation Advisory Group (RIAG). He started his career in 1982 developing new algorithms for seismic processing in the research department of the Elf-Aquitaine oil company. He then moved to the Silicon valley as an application engineer and took part in a couple of startup projects, including a parallel supercomputer for Evans & Sutherland in 1989. During the following 20 years, he worked for SGI successively as application engineer, leader of the HPC application group and Chief Engineer. In 2009, he joined Bull, now an Atos company, where he is responsible for the HPC developments. Jean-Pierre holds an engineer degree from Ecole Nationale Supérieure des Mines de Paris.
